How Reliable is the Nissan Cabstar?

Based on 343,105 MOT tests across 28,370 vehicles.

64.2%
Pass Rate
5,579
Miles/Year
34
Year Lifespan
28,370
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 27,729
Service brake: efficiency below requirements 18,241
Shock absorber has an excessively worn bush 13,616
Se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ded 10,899
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 10,527

YK04 RTH is a 2004 Nissan Cabstar in Red with a 2,953c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.

Across all 2004 Nissan Cabstar models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.5% with a typical mileage of 72,834 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Cabstar f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 27,729 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YK04 RTH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Cabstar typ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 22 years old, this Nissan Cabstar is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
